Hatami, J., Andrade, P. Z., de Matos, A. P. A., Djokovic, D., Lilaia, C., Ferreira, F. C., ... & da Silva, C. L. (2015). Developing a co-culture system for effective megakaryo/thrombopoiesis from umbilical cord blood hematopoietic stem/progenitor cells. Cytotherapy, 17(4), 428-442. In this study, a two-stage culture protocol was exploited aiming to study the effect of different parameters on the megakaryo/thrombopoiesis ex vivo. In the expansion stage, human umbilical cord blood (UCB)-derived CD34(+)-enriched cells were expanded in co-culture with human bone marrow mesenchymal stromal cells (BM-MSCs). The megakaryocytic commitment and platelet generation were studied, considering the impact of exogenous addition of thrombopoietin (TPO) in the expansion stage and a cytokine cocktail (Cyt) including TPO and interleukin-3 in the differentiation stage, with the use of different culture medium formulations, and in the presence/absence of BM-MSCs (direct versus non-direct cell-cell contact). UCB CD34+-enriched cells were seeded to a T25 flask (BD) with the use of QBSF-60 (Quality Biological Inc) as an expansion culture medium at the density of 3.0 × 104cells/mL, over a mitomycin C–treated BM-MSC feeder layer. QBSF-60 is a commercial and proprietary serum-free medium. https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S1465324915000067 |
